Ace Saatchi & Saatchi celebrates 68 years with Children’s Hour

On the occasion of its 68th anniversary, Ace Saatchi & Saatchi took the opportunity to celebrate by sharing its blessings with the children of war-torn Marawi.

Compassionate employees took part in the efforts of Children’s Hour, giving them the opportunity to donate at least one hour of their salary. A total of PHP100,000 was raised for the No Small Change Campaign, which provides school supplies, hygiene kits, malongs and shoes for the children in Marawi, who struggle to continue with their studies at evacuation centers amidst war and trauma.

The donation was turned over in a simple ceremony held at the Ace Saatchi office on August 11, 2017, immediately following the annual anniversary thanksgiving mass.

“Our 68th anniversary, which allowed us to look back on what we have accomplished so far and be thankful for all our blessings, was the perfect opportunity for us to share these blessings with those who truly need it,” said Mio Chongson, Ace Saatchi President and COO.

Children’s Hour is a fund-raising NGO that supports projects on education, health & nutrition, and child welfare & development for the benefit of disadvantaged Filipino children nationwide. Its vision is to give Filipino children the basic right to enjoy a happy, safe, and fulfilling future.
